Transaction 5eabceeb51ba176f9bb04ca818f3c4f6d97053a788e4043e27829d52524a288e

2 Input
1 Outputs
  • 5eabceeb51ba176f9bb04ca818f3c4f6d97053a788e4043e27829d52524a288e:0
  • value  16404
    address  3HjBHngXkiet7To2EJ1AB3dRrCBcaWVrHz